1) Files that we wrote.
2) Files that we imported from GameSWF and made no major changes to.
    e.g. libbase/demo.h
3) Files that we imported from GameSWF and made major changes to.
    e.g. libbase/tu_types.h
4) Files that we imported from other projects and made no major changes to.
    e.g. gui/gtk_cairo_create.h

Historically that's interesting, but legally headers such as

// Thatcher Ulrich <address@hidden> 2003 -*- coding: utf-8;-*-

// This source code has been donated to the Public Domain.  Do
// whatever you want with it.

also allow applying the GPL to your own copy of the code.
If we can publish it all as a pure GPL product I think that simplifies
issues for users.
